§15–502.
(a)This section applies to each individual or group policy or certificate of health insurance or automobile insurance that is:
(1)delivered or issued for delivery in the State by an insurer or nonprofit health service plan; and
(2)issued, renewed, amended, or reissued on or after July 1, 1978.
(b)A policy or certificate subject to this section that provides or pays for health care benefits may not contain a provision that denies or reduces benefits because services are rendered to a policyholder, certificate holder, or beneficiary who is eligible for or receives medical assistance under § 15-103 of the Health - General Article.
